Description
This qualification has been developed with, and aligned to, the foundation fire risk assessment competencies outlined in BS 8674: 2025 – Built Environment Framework for Competence of Individual Fire Risk Assessors.
The aims of this qualification are:
- To introduce the principles, procedures and legislation of fire risk assessment
- To prepare candidates for undertaking and reporting out on fire risk assessments
The awarding body for this qualification is ProQual AB. This qualification has been approved for delivery in England. The regulatory body for this qualification is Ofqual, and this qualification has been accredited onto the Regulated Qualification Framework (RQF) and has been published in Ofqual’s Register of Qualifications.
Candidates who complete this qualification may progress onto the ProQual Level 4 Certificate in Intermediate Fire Risk Assessment.
This course is delivered via a blended learning structure:
- 5-days classroom based learning
- Each candidate is then required to produce a portfolio of evidence which demonstrates their achievement of all learning outcomes and assessment criteria for each unit
Evidence can include:
- Assignments/projects/reports
- Professional discussion
- Candidate product
- Worksheets
- Record of oral and written questioning
- Recognition of Prior Learning.
